Yesterday we revealed our speaking avatar of King Richard III at York Theatre Royal. The culmination of a 10 year journey to give the facial reconstruction from his skeletal remains a voice. Read more on Sky News & watch the full speech on YouTube youtu.be/FbH_KLMs6aY news.sky.com/video/scient...

Scientists reveal recreated voice of King Richard III

Scientists have spent 10 years recreating the voice of King Richard III and are showcasing the findings today. The recreation suggests the monarch had a northern accent.
